Full Description
This exam focuses on nutritional science principles in veterinary contexts, examining dietary requirements, nutrient metabolism, and the development of nutrition plans for various species.
Nutrition plays a crucial role in maintaining animal health and performance. A solid understanding of nutritional needs and dietary management is essential for effective veterinary care, influencing growth and recovery.
The exam will assess the studentβs verbal skills in discussing nutrient functions, formulating diets, and analyzing the impact of nutrition on animal health outcomes.
Students should be prepared to apply theoretical concepts to case studies, demonstrating critical thinking in creating nutritional plans tailored to specific animal needs.
Sample Questions
- What are the key nutrients required for optimal growth in puppies?
- How does dietary imbalance affect overall health in ruminant animals?
